A 4’ x 22’ long live edge claro walnut slab was used to build a custom conference table that is now the centerpiece of a business outside of Orlando, Florida. The unique live edge table was installed into the center of the building in a 20’ x 40’ room with glass walls on either side. Each individual office runs along side the table looking toward the center of the building where the 22’ custom conference table resides sitting upon a steel base on a concrete floor. The owner of the business flew to Montana and drove to our solar powered wood shop to discuss design features. Discussing electrical cutouts for the table top, table base options and moved onto an executive desk with return for his office. He ended up using 3 steel I-beams for the base of his boardroom conference table. He was amazed at the beauty and variety of color in his live edge claro walnut top!

Types of Custom Wood Coffee Tables
When it comes to choosing a custom wood coffee table for your living space, there are a variety of options to consider. Each type of wood and style offers a unique look and feel to complement your home decor.
One popular option is the traditional hardwood coffee table, known for its durability and timeless appeal. Another option is a reclaimed wood coffee table, which adds a rustic and eco-friendly touch to your space. For a more modern look, consider a sleek and minimalist design crafted from teak or walnut.
If you’re looking for something truly unique, consider a live edge wood coffee table, which showcases the natural edge of the wood for a one-of-a-kind piece. Or, for a touch of elegance, a hand-carved wood coffee table adds intricate detailing and craftsmanship.
Whatever your style preferences, there is a custom wood coffee table to suit your needs and elevate your living space.
